Gallbladder cancer has no specific and typical symptoms in the early stage, making it difficult to diagnose and poorly treated. Gallbladder cancer is one of the more common malignant tumors in the human bile duct system. According to surveys, gallbladder cancer ranks fifth among digestive tract tumors in my country, and its incidence accounts for about 0.75-1.2% of all cancers, with an increasing trend in recent years. The cause of gallbladder cancer is still unclear, but it is speculated that the cause is related to the long-term stimulation of cholelithiasis. 70-96.9% of patients have concurrent gallstones.

The main symptoms of advanced gallbladder cancer are right upper abdominal pain, jaundice, a hard mass in the right upper abdomen, and weight loss. The presence of jaundice indicates that there has been lymph node metastasis and obstruction of the extrahepatic bile duct, and the tumor can no longer be surgically removed; jaundice may also occur if combined with stone obstruction. Gallbladder cancer spreads directly to the stomach and duodenum, which can cause gastric pyloric obstruction. The metastasis of gallbladder cancer is early and extensive, and the most common is liver metastasis of gallbladder cancer. Cholangiocarcinoma refers to cancer originating in the extrahepatic bile duct, excluding intrahepatic cholangiocarcinoma, gallbladder cancer, and ampullary cancer. It is divided into upper bile duct cancer, middle bile duct cancer, and lower bile duct cancer. The main manifestations are rapidly progressive obstructive jaundice, weight loss, gallbladder enlargement, liver enlargement, and digestive tract symptoms; loss of appetite, indigestion, fear of greasy food, etc. Abdominal pain and acute cholangitis symptoms are rare, and it is difficult to clinically distinguish them from pancreatic head cancer or periampullary cancer. In the late stage of gallbladder cancer, obvious weight loss, fatigue, and cachexia can be seen.

Foods that are not suitable for patients with gallbladder cancer:

1. Avoid animal fat and greasy food.

2. Avoid overeating and overeating.

3. Avoid smoking, drinking and spicy food.

4. Avoid moldy, fried, smoked, and pickled foods.

5. Avoid hard, sticky and indigestible foods.
